Renegade hosts Tattoo for the Paws fundraiser

SAVANNAH, Ga. () — Renegade Paws held a fundraiser on Saturday where around 100 people lined up to get a tattoo for the paws.

The fundraiser was held outside of Drop Dead Tattoo where people were encouraged to exchange a donation between $50 and $100 for a tattoo.

This marks the third consecutive year for this fundraiser, with organizers highlighting that every dollar raised supports an animal in need, as all profits go to Renegade Paws Rescue.

“All the funds are directed back into Renegade for veterinary care, medical expenses, boarding… Our foster families don’t incur any costs, so we provide everything our foster dogs need, from food and beds to any other necessities,” stated Rachel Goode, the event’s lead coordinator at Renegade Paws.

Goode also said that the raised money also helps the animals that stay in their office and shelter.
